Band 6+: Nowadays, not enough students choose science subjects at university in many countries. Why is this? What effects does this have on society?

Note: Both the topic and the essay were created by one of our users.

At present, student’s inclination towards studying science related topics has witnessed a downfall in the universities in many nations. Many factors have contributed to this trend, and it may have detrimental effects on the society.

To commence with the reasons of not opting for science subjects, firstly, attaining desired scores in the field of science is a daunting task for many pupils as rigorous practice is required for cracking entrance exams in such discipline. Secondly, students are unable to endure the stress caused by fierce competition and societal pressure. To exemplify, in India, one third of science students have suicidal thoughts owing to excessive load given by parents to own the title of a doctor or a scientist. Another reason could be the lucrative salaries earned by people studying business management and engineering subjects as well. For instance, Indra Nooyi, Chief executive officer of renowned company like PepsiCo, studied business at school.

Turning towards the negative effects of leaving science subjects, firstly, there can be scarcity of science professionals and the chances of finding the breakthrough in medical and other fields would reduce and people might have to wait longer for getting the adequate treatment which can result into severe health issues. For instance, in Canada, waiting period to receive the treatment for illnesses like kidney stones, is three to six months due to shortage of health professionals. Moreover, science-related industries play a crucial role in the economic development and shortage of scientists could hinder innovation and growth.

To conclude, though taking business subjects can be advantageous for individuals, entering the science field would bring fruitful results for people and the society as well. So, authorities must take initiatives to encourage students for taking science discipline.
